Transaction 64e6ebc69d5667aacb39b6e6128ab5b5a3cb2811117b1020a8f1b720257580f7
1 Input
2 Outputs
- 64e6ebc69d5667aacb39b6e6128ab5b5a3cb2811117b1020a8f1b720257580f7:0
- 64e6ebc69d5667aacb39b6e6128ab5b5a3cb2811117b1020a8f1b720257580f7:1
value 14924
address 3CdHMzCzoEbGX7Z11bUFqPeSENcWPfiW2m
value 29153
address 1EBxax5iKNKTXmRe5Tewx4ThToxKNZUe8T